#d476f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d476f4 is composed of 83.1% red, 46.3%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.1% cyan, 51.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 284.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 71%. #d476f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ffecff with #a900e9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#d476f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d476f4 has RGB values of R:212, G:118,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 13924084.

Shades and Tints of #d476f4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060108 is the darkest color, while #fcf5fe is the lightest one.
